What do we mean by leadership? Where does influence fit in? What are some of the "best practices" in leadership over time and how do they apply to modern business today?

"Best Practices are the practices chosen of world class leaders who have used their influence to change their environment - government or business - for the good, or to improve their organizations success ratio”.

Organizational development literature contains a wide variety of definitions and descriptions of leadership. Some people argue that leadership and management are quite different and that they require a different perspective and skills. Others hold that leadership is a facet of management and that influencing is a facet of leadership. In the context of this program, we will take a broad view:

"A leader is someone who sets the direction and influences people to follow in that direction.”
